What causes a vitamin B12 deficiency? The most common causes
A vitamin B12 deficiency rarely develops overnight. It's usually the result of a long process in which either too little B12 enters your body or your body can no longer absorb it properly. Think of your B12 stores like a bank account: if you withdraw more than you deposit for months on end, the account will eventually run out.
The reasons for this are surprisingly varied and often a combination of several factors. Let's take a closer look at what can empty your memory.

When diet becomes a B12 trap
Perhaps the most well-known reason for depleted B12 stores lies on our plates. This vitamin is produced by microorganisms and is found almost exclusively in animal products, because animals absorb and store it through their food.
For you as a health-conscious person, it's important to know where to find this vitamin. The best sources of B12 are:
- Meat: Liver and red meat in particular are veritable B12 bombs.
- Fish and seafood: Salmon, tuna and mussels also provide plenty of it.
- Dairy products and eggs: They also contribute to daily nutrition.
If you follow a vegan or very strict vegetarian diet, it's almost impossible to meet your vitamin B12 needs through food alone. While you might sometimes hear about plant-based alternatives like sauerkraut or algae, these usually only contain so-called B12 analogs – a form of the vitamin that your body can't utilize. In this case, targeted supplementation isn't just a nice bonus, but simply essential to avoid the symptoms of vitamin B12 deficiency .
When the body blocks absorption
Sometimes, however, the problem isn't with your diet at all, but with your body itself. The absorption of vitamin B12 is a surprisingly complex process that can fail at several points.
Imagine it like this: Vitamin B12 is like a VIP guest. To enter the exclusive area (your bloodstream), it needs a personal invitation – the so-called intrinsic factor , a special protein from your stomach. If this invitation is missing, or if the gatekeeper (your intestinal lining) is damaged, the VIP stays outside.
This is precisely where the hidden causes of a deficiency often lurk:
- Stomach problems: Chronic gastritis or certain autoimmune diseases can impair the production of intrinsic factor. Without it, vitamin B12 has no chance of being absorbed.
- Certain medications: Some drugs are known to deplete B12 levels. These include, most notably, metformin (for diabetes) and acid blockers (such as omeprazole), which reduce stomach acid and thus prevent B12 from being released from food.
- Gastrointestinal diseases: Diseases such as Crohn's disease or celiac disease can damage your intestinal lining so that it can no longer absorb the vitamin – the "gatekeeper" is, so to speak, out of action.
- Age: As people age, the stomach often produces less acid and less intrinsic factor. This is why older people are one of the highest risk groups.

Physical signs you shouldn't ignore
Besides mental exhaustion, your body also sends visible and noticeable signals. These physical symptoms of a vitamin B12 deficiency are often the first concrete indications that something is wrong.
A classic sign is a noticeable paleness of the skin . This is because vitamin B12 is essential for the formation of healthy red blood cells. In the case of a deficiency, the few blood cells produced can be too large and misshapen – a condition known as megaloblastic anemia. This impairs oxygen transport in the body and leads to a pale, sometimes almost yellowish, skin tone.
Key finding: Paleness is not just a cosmetic problem in the case of a B12 deficiency. It is a direct sign that your blood can no longer transport oxygen efficiently – which in turn exacerbates your fatigue and lack of energy.

When the deficiency progresses and the nerves suffer
If you ignore the first, often subtle signs of a vitamin B12 deficiency, your body won't give up. On the contrary, it will only cry out for help more loudly. If a deficiency remains undetected for a long time, it can cause serious and sometimes even permanent damage, especially to your nervous system.
Think of vitamin B12 as a protective sheath for your nerve pathways. This vitamin is essential for building and maintaining the myelin sheath , a kind of insulating fatty layer that surrounds your nerves. You can think of it like the rubber insulation of an electrical cable: it ensures that electrical signals travel from point A to point B quickly and without interference.
However, if vitamin B12 is lacking, this protective layer becomes thin and porous. The "cables" are essentially exposed, and the entire signal transmission falters. This is the point at which the neurological symptoms of a vitamin B12 deficiency become noticeable – and they go far beyond simple fatigue.
When hands and feet tingle and become numb
One of the most common and worrying symptoms is polyneuropathy . The word sounds complicated, but it describes a very specific and unpleasant sensation: tingling, burning, or numbness, which usually starts in the hands and feet.
You might be familiar with that annoying tingling or pins-and-needles sensation in your leg. However, in polyneuropathy caused by vitamin B12 deficiency, this feeling is constant and can slowly spread.
In everyday life, this can feel like this:
- You constantly feel like you have cold feet, even though they actually feel warm.
- When reaching for objects, you feel uncertain, as if your fingers are no longer obeying you properly.
- You wake up at night because your hands or arms tingle or feel like they've fallen asleep.
These abnormal sensations are a direct distress signal from your nerves. They indicate that the myelin sheath has already been damaged.
When coordination and memory decline
But the damage to the nerve pathways isn't limited to the hands and feet. The major nerve tracts in the spinal cord, responsible for your balance and coordination, can also be affected.
This leads to symptoms that can significantly impair your movements and your safety in everyday life:
- Gait instability: You stumble more often, feel unsteady on uneven ground, or have the feeling of swaying.
- Coordination problems: Fine motor tasks such as buttoning a shirt or writing suddenly become a real challenge.
- Muscle weakness: Your legs feel heavy, and climbing stairs is suddenly unexpectedly strenuous.
It is crucial to act quickly as soon as neurological symptoms of a vitamin B12 deficiency appear. Many types of damage can be reversed with timely treatment. However, a severe, prolonged deficiency can lead to irreversible nerve damage.

The classic serum test: often only half the truth
The most common test measures total vitamin B12 in blood serum. Imagine it like taking inventory in a warehouse: the test simply counts all the B12 packets lying around. The major problem is that it doesn't distinguish between "active" and "inactive" packets. A large portion of the measured B12 is bound to a protein called haptocorrin and is therefore unusable by your cells.
This test can therefore give you a false sense of security. Your results could be within the normal range, even though your cells are already lacking the urgently needed, active vitamin B12.
More precise markers for a clear image
To truly understand what's going on in your body, we need to take a closer look. Here, two more modern and significantly more informative markers come into play:
- Holo-transcobalamin (Holo-TC): This is the so-called "active B12." Only the portion of the vitamin bound to the transport protein transcobalamin is measured here – precisely the form that your cells can actually absorb and utilize. A low Holo-TC level is often the very first sign of an emerging deficiency, long before the total B12 level even drops.
- Methylmalonic acid (MMA): This is a metabolic product that accumulates in the body when there is insufficient vitamin B12 for certain chemical reactions. An elevated MMA level is therefore a very reliable indicator of a functional deficiency directly at the cellular level.
Simply put: While the serum B12 test only counts the supplies in the warehouse, the holo-TC test shows you how much of it is actually being shipped. The MMA test checks whether the employees in the cells are already complaining about a lack of supplies.

Comparison of test methods for vitamin B12
This table shows the common blood tests for determining B12 status, their significance, and for whom they are suitable.
| Test procedure | What is being measured? | Meaning & Recommendation |
|---|---|---|
| Total B12 (Serum) | The total amount of B12 in the blood, active and inactive. | Limited informative value. May overlook a defect. Suitable only as a rough initial indication. |
| Holo-TC (Active B12) | Only the biologically available B12 bound to transcobalamin. | Highly informative. Considered an early marker, it reliably indicates a deficiency, often before symptoms appear. |
| MMA (methylmalonic acid) | A metabolic product that increases in cases of vitamin B12 deficiency. | Very high diagnostic accuracy. Confirms a functional deficiency at the cellular level. Ideal in combination with Holo-TC. |
As you can see, Holo-TC and MMA provide a much clearer picture of your B12 status.
The importance of early detection is also growing at the societal level. For example, the Federal Joint Committee (G-BA) in Germany has decided to expand newborn screening to include vitamin B12 deficiency starting around May 2026. This step aims to detect rare but serious congenital metabolic disorders early and thus prevent irreversible developmental problems. Which therapy is right for you depends entirely on the cause and severity of your deficiency. If your body can't properly absorb the vitamin, for example due to a gastrointestinal illness, tablets are often ineffective. In this case, injections, which completely bypass the digestive tract, are usually the fastest and safest solution to replenish depleted stores.
Find the right therapy for your needs
For a mild deficiency, perhaps caused solely by your diet, high-dose supplements in tablet, capsule, or drop form can be the perfect solution. Your doctor will advise you on the correct dosage.
A look at the most common treatment options:
- High-dose tablets or drops: This is the most common method. A proper dose is important here, as your body can only actively absorb a small portion when taken orally.
- Vitamin B12 injections: In cases of severe deficiency or impaired absorption, your doctor will inject the vitamin directly into the muscle. This way, it enters the bloodstream directly and can quickly alleviate the symptoms of vitamin B12 deficiency .
- Nasal sprays: A less common, but equally effective alternative. Here, the vitamin is absorbed through the nasal mucosa.
Important note: You should always make the decision about a therapy together with your doctor. They are best able to assess which path is safest and most effective for you to replenish your energy stores.
Active forms for maximum effect
If you decide to take a vitamin B12 supplement, you'll quickly encounter different forms of the substance. The two most important are methylcobalamin and cyanocobalamin. And the difference between them is crucial.
- Methylcobalamin is the biologically active form. Your body can use it immediately without having to convert it first. It is directly available to you.
- Cyanocobalamin is a synthetic, very stable form. However, your body first has to convert it into an active form, which means an additional step.
For a fast and direct effect , methylcobalamin is often the better choice . When selecting a product, simply look for high-quality preparations that do without unnecessary additives.
